S-FRAME Analysis is described as 'Structural Analysis with Integrated Concrete and Steel Design' and is an app. There are more than 50 alternatives to S-FRAME Analysis for Windows, Linux, Web-based and Mac. The best S-FRAME Analysis alternative is RodX, which is free. Other great apps like S-FRAME Analysis are Robot Structural Analysis Professional, Etabs, SAP2000 and Abaqus Unified FEA.
